HICKS William married Mary TRAHAIR 1865

Journal by tonkin

Information Journal.

Groom: William Henry HICKS.
Bride: Mary TRAHAIR.

Year married: 1865.
Place: Victoria, Australia.

William died 1912 Sebastopol, Victoria.
Age: 71 years.
Parents named as William HICKS and Maria RODDA.

Mary died 1934 Bininyong, Victoria.
Age: 90 years.
Parents named as Nicholas TRAHAIR and Elizabeth WILLIAMS.

Ten children located Victoria for William and Mary.
